Why is it necessary to cool stingless bee propolis samples to -18 °C before crushing? Master Propolis Processing


Pre-cooling stingless bee propolis to -18 °C is a mandatory step to alter its physical state for processing. In its natural form, propolis is a sticky, resinous substance that adheres to machinery and resists grinding. Freezing the sample induces brittleness, allowing mechanical crushers to fracture the material into a fine powder rather than merely deforming it or gumming up the equipment.

The freezing process does more than facilitate grinding; it protects the sample's chemical profile. By starting at -18 °C, you minimize the heat generated during crushing, preventing the evaporation of volatile compounds and ensuring an accurate analysis.

Overcoming Physical Limitations

Managing Resinous Properties

Stingless bee propolis is naturally adhesive and pliable at room temperature. Without temperature intervention, the material acts like a gum.

Attempting to crush it at ambient temperatures results in the material sticking to the grinding blades and vessel walls. This leads to equipment blockages and significant sample loss.

Inducing Brittleness for Grinding

Low temperatures drastically change the mechanical properties of the resin. At -18 °C, the propolis becomes hard and brittle.

This state allows mechanical forces to shatter the material effectively. Instead of stretching or smearing, the frozen resin breaks apart, enabling the production of a granular, consistent powder.

Enhancing Analytical Precision

Maximizing Surface Area

The ultimate goal of crushing is to produce a fine powder.

A finer powder possesses a significantly higher specific surface area compared to coarse chunks. This increased surface area improves the efficiency of subsequent solvent extraction, ensuring that more active compounds are released from the matrix.

Mitigating Thermal Degradation

Mechanical crushing inherently generates heat through friction. This rise in temperature poses a risk to the sample's chemical integrity.

If the sample heats up, sensitive volatile components may be lost through evaporation before they can be analyzed. Starting with a sample at -18 °C acts as a thermal buffer, keeping the material cool enough to preserve these volatiles for accurate headspace analysis.

Operational Considerations

The Time-Sensitivity of Processing

While freezing is effective, it is temporary. The increased surface area of the powder means it will warm up rapidly once removed from the cold environment.

Operators must work quickly. If the powder is allowed to return to room temperature before processing is complete, it may revert to its sticky state, clumping together and negating the benefits of the grinding process.

Making the Right Choice for Your Goal

To ensure the highest quality results, align your preparation method with your analytical objectives:

  • If your primary focus is Extraction Yield: Ensure the sample is fully frozen to -18 °C to achieve the finest possible powder, which maximizes solvent contact.
  • If your primary focus is Volatile Profiling: Rely on the pre-cooling step to counteract frictional heat, preserving the delicate aromatic compounds required for headspace analysis.

Freezing is not merely a convenience; it is a prerequisite for obtaining a chemically representative and physically manageable sample.

Summary Table:

Feature At Room Temperature At -18 °C (Frozen)
Physical State Sticky, resinous, and pliable Hard, brittle, and glass-like
Grinding Effect Deforms, smears, and gums up tools Shatters into fine, granular powder
Thermal Stability High risk of volatile loss from friction Acts as a buffer to preserve compounds
Extraction Efficiency Low (clumping reduces surface area) High (fine powder increases surface area)
